Uuri kõiki arvustusi

Mis on Lightning Network?

2016. aasta valges raamatus välja pakutud Lightning Network (LN) on Bitcoinile ehitatud teise kihi lahendus.
Mis on Lightning Network?
Selles artiklis süveneme Bitcoini Lightning Networki ajalukku ja praegusesse olukorda.

Miks loodi Bitcoini Lightning Network?

Lightning Network loodi vastusena Bitcoini mastaabitavuse probleemidele, nimelt Bitcoini tehingute kiirusele ja kuludele.

Bitcoini praegune teoreetiline maksimaalne tehingute arv sekundis (TPS) on 10, kuigi reaalsuses jääb see vahemikku 3 kuni 7. Võrdluseks, traditsioonilised makseprotsessorid nagu VISA töötlesid 2020. aastal keskmiselt 6000 TPS-i (põhinedes VISA väitel 188 miljardi tehingu kohta aastas).

Bitcoini tehingutasud võivad varieeruda sõltuvalt võrgu kasutamise nõudlusest. Näiteks 20. aprillil 2021 oli keskmine tehingutasu üle $50, samas kui 9. augustil 2021 oli keskmine umbes $2.50. Suurte tehingute, näiteks pangaülekannete või rahvusvaheliste ülekannete puhul on Bitcoini kiirus ja kulud võrreldavad või paremad kui alternatiividel. Kuid kui Bitcoini tahetakse kasutada igapäevaste maksete (nn mikro-tehingute, nt kohvitassi või kütuse ostmiseks) jaoks, peab tehingukiirus suurenema ja tehingukulud drastiliselt vähenema.

Lightning Network teoorias

LN-i töö mõistmiseks ja praeguste LN-i väljakutsete mõistmiseks peame rääkima Bitcoinist. Bitcoini võrgu piiravaks teguriks on see, et iga tehing tuleb panna uude plokki ahelas. Kuna plokid lisatakse ahelasse umbes iga 10 minuti järel, on olemas kindel piir tehingute arvule, mis on võimalik ilma Bitcoini protokolli märkimisväärselt muutmata.

Loe edasi: Kuidas Bitcoini tehingud toimivad?

Debatid Bitcoini protokolli suuremate muutmiste üle on toimunud varem ja viinud 'kõvade kahvliteni', millest kõige tuntum on Bitcoin Cashi loomine. Lightning Network on kihiline lahendus, mis tähendab, et see võimaldab Bitcoini protokollil jääda suhteliselt muutumatuks, pakkudes samas kasu, mida suured muutmised võiksid tuua - vähemalt teoorias.

LN töötab maksekanali loomisega kahe osapoole vahel, kus ainult esimene ja viimane tehing pannakse Bitcoini plokiahelasse. Kõik esimesse ja viimasesse vahele jäävad tehingud toimuvad ahelaväliselt, mis tähendab, et neid tehinguid ei piira Bitcoini protokoll.

Maksekanali avamiseks peavad mõlemad pooled pühendama teatud hulga Bitcoini. See Bitcoin hoitakse ja seda ei saa vabastada, kuni maksekanal on avatud. Kanali kaudu edastatav Bitcoini kogusumma on pühendatud Bitcoini kogusumma. Vaatame näidet, et seda illustreerida:

Alice ja Bob soovivad luua omavahel maksekanali. Alice pühendab 10 BTC ja Bob pühendab 5 BTC maksekanalisse. Alustav tehing, mis hoiab Alice'i ja Bobi kombineeritud 15 BTC, pannakse Bitcoini plokiahelasse. Kui see tehing on plokiahelasse lisatud, mis võib võtta 10 minutit või rohkem, saavad Alice ja Bob teha piiramatu arvu tehinguid palju kiirema kiirusega ja praktiliselt nullkuluga. Allpool on tehingud Alice'i ja Bobi vahel:

  1. Alice saadab Bobile 1 BTC Alice: 9 BTC Bob: 6 BTC
  2. Alice saadab Bobile 2 BTC Alice: 7 BTC Bob: 8 BTC
  3. Bob saadab Alice'ile 3 BTC Alice: 10 BTC Bob: 5 BTC
  4. Bob saadab Alice'ile 1 BTC Alice: 11 BTC Bob: 4 BTC

Kui üks või mõlemad soovivad kanali sulgeda, saadetakse plokiahelasse lõppsaldo Alice'i ja Bobiga. Sel juhul on Alice'i lõppsaldo 11 BTC ja Bobi 4 BTC.

Mis siis, kui Alice soovib tehingut teha Caroliga? Juhtub nii, et Bobil on maksekanal Caroliga, nii et Alice teeb tehingu Bobiga ja Bob edastab tehingu Carolile. Pange tähele, et sellises olukorras võib Bob võtta tehingu edastamise eest väikese tasu. Aja jooksul võimaldab kuue eraldusastme teooria LN Alice'il teha tehinguid kellega tahes.

Lightning Network node mesh network Sõlm A teeb tehingu sõlm Q-ga, kuigi tal on otsemaksekanalid ainult sõlmedega C ja B.

Lightning Network praktikas

LN on suhteliselt uus protokoll. Sellega kaasnevad paljud väljakutsed, alates kasutusmugavusest kuni turvalisuseni.

On muresid selle üle, kui lihtne on LN-sõlme käitada. Et LN oleks edukas, vajab see tugevat Bitcoini sõlmede võrku, mis käitavad LN protokolli. LN-sõlme käitamine võib olla üsna keeruline ja võib olla, et väiksemate sõlmede käitamise eest makstavad tasud on probleemid. Võib väita, et LN-i käitamine ei ole palju raskem kui täis Bitcoini sõlme käitamine. Kuid kuna LN on peamiselt suunatud mikro-tehingutele, toimub igapäevane kogemus LN-iga läbi LN-toega rahakottide. Erinevalt mõningatest enam levinud Bitcoini rahakottidest tähendab nende LN-toega rahakottide uudsus kompromisse vahel hooldaja- ja mittehooldaja- versioonide vahel. Mittehooldaja LN rahakottide kasutamine on keerulisem - segasem, vähem sirgjooneline. Hooldaja valikud on lihtsamad kasutada, kuid peate lootma kolmandale osapoolele oma Bitcoini hoidmiseks.

Loe edasi: Mõista hooldaja ja mittehooldaja rahakottide erinevust ja kuidas see on seotud majandusliku vabadusega.

LN peab ka konkureerima konkurentidega. 2024. aasta veebruari seisuga on LN-is lukustatud umbes 5000 BTC. See võib tunduda palju, kuid võrdluseks on Ethereumis (WBTC, pakitud Bitcoin) lukustatud üle 150 000 Bitcoini 2024. aasta veebruari seisuga. Kuna plokiaeg Ethereumis on ligikaudu iga 14 sekundi järel, vastupidiselt Bitcoini 10 minutile, on juba palju kiirem Bitcoini tehinguid teha Ethereumis WBTC kaudu. Edasi, on ettekujutatav, et Ethereumi projektid nagu ETH 2.0 ja Ethereum Plasma vähendavad tehingutasusid piisavalt, et muuta Lightning Network mittevajalikuks ja vananenud. Samuti on oluline meeles pidada, et WBTC kasutamine toob endaga kaasa kõik suured eelised DeFi-le juurdepääsuks, mida LN ei paku.

Lõpuks ja kõige häirivamalt on LN silmitsi mitmete haavatavustega. Nende hulka kuuluvad:

  • Griefing rünnakud: Vahendid ei lähe kaduma, kuid see põhjustab ohvri Lightningi vahendite külmutamise, nii et maksekanal ei saa tehinguid töödelda.
  • Flood ja loot: Ründaja sunnib paljusid ohvreid nõudma oma vahendeid plokiahelast samal ajal (tulv). Ründaja kasutab seda ummikut, et varastada vahendeid, mida ei olnud võimalik enne tähtaega nõuda (rööv).
  • Aja dilatatsiooni rünnakud: Ründaja pikendab aega, mille jooksul ohver jõuab teadlikuks uutest plokkidest, blokeerides plokkide edastamise.
  • Pinning rünnakud: Ründaja petab ohvri sulgema oma LN-kanali valesti ja varastab individuaalsed tehingud.

Bitcoini Lightning Networkil veel tehtavat tööd

Kuigi LN kannatab haavatavuste all, pole keegi neid veel ära kasutanud. Tõenäoliselt on see tingitud sellest, et nende haavatavuste ärakasutamiseks vajalikud teadmised on nii kõrged, et keegi pole seda teinud. LN-i arendajad on kindlad, et nende haavatavuste leidmine muudab võrgu ainult tugevamaks - see on vajalik kasvufaas. Arendajad on optimistlikud, et nad suudavad leida erinevaid lahendusi siiani leitud haavatavustele, kuigi pinning rünnakud ja aja dilatatsiooni rünnakud vajavad korraga nii LN-i rakenduste kui ka Bitcoini tuuma kohandamist.

Tänapäeva Lightning Network seisab silmitsi paljude väljakutsetega, kuid protokoll on endiselt suhteliselt noor ja sellised probleemid on oodatavad. Lightningi arendajad jätkavad protokolli täiustamist ja võivad suuta lahendada probleeme, et aidata Bitcoini skaleerida teisel kihil.

Loe edasi: Mõista Bitcoini ja Bitcoin Cashi erinevusi ning miks Bitcoin Cash teenib peamiselt teistsugust kasutusjuhtumit.

Antoine Riardi suurepärase postituse jaoks, mis on kirjutatud täiskohaga Bitcoini tuumakontribuudi poolt, vaadake kainet Lightning Networki 10 000 jala kõrguse hinnangut.

Avasta krüptovaluutade ostmiseks, müümiseks ja vahetamiseks parimad platvormid.

Avasta krüptovaluutade ostmiseks, müümiseks ja vahetamiseks parimad platvormid.

Seotud juhendid

Alusta siit →
Mis on Bitcoin?

Mis on Bitcoin?

Saage lihtne sissejuhatus Bitcoini ja selle tähtsuse kohta.

Loe seda artiklit →
Mis on Bitcoin?

Mis on Bitcoin?

Saage lihtne sissejuhatus Bitcoini ja selle tähtsuse kohta.

Kuidas saata bitcoini?

Kuidas saata bitcoini?

Bitcoini saatmine on sama lihtne kui summa valimine ja otsustamine, kuhu see läheb. Lisateabe saamiseks lugege artiklit.

Loe seda artiklit →
Kuidas saata bitcoini?

Kuidas saata bitcoini?

Bitcoini saatmine on sama lihtne kui summa valimine ja otsustamine, kuhu see läheb. Lisateabe saamiseks lugege artiklit.

Kuidas ma saan bitcoini vastu võtta?

Kuidas ma saan bitcoini vastu võtta?

Bitcoini saamiseks anna saatjale lihtsalt oma Bitcoini aadress, mille leiad oma Bitcoini rahakotist. Lisateabe saamiseks loe seda artiklit.

Loe seda artiklit →
Kuidas ma saan bitcoini vastu võtta?

Kuidas ma saan bitcoini vastu võtta?

Bitcoini saamiseks anna saatjale lihtsalt oma Bitcoini aadress, mille leiad oma Bitcoini rahakotist. Lisateabe saamiseks loe seda artiklit.

Kuidas bitcoin tehingud toimivad?

Kuidas bitcoin tehingud toimivad?

Mõista, kuidas Bitcoin'i avalik plokiahel aja jooksul omandiõigust jälgib. Saavuta selgus võtmeterminites nagu avalikud ja privaatvõtmed, tehingu sisendid ja väljundid, kinnitamisajad ja palju muud.

Loe seda artiklit →
Kuidas bitcoin tehingud toimivad?

Kuidas bitcoin tehingud toimivad?

Mõista, kuidas Bitcoin'i avalik plokiahel aja jooksul omandiõigust jälgib. Saavuta selgus võtmeterminites nagu avalikud ja privaatvõtmed, tehingu sisendid ja väljundid, kinnitamisajad ja palju muud.

check icon
USALDUSVÄÄRNE ÜLE 5 MILJONI KRÜPTOKASUTAJA ÜLE MAAILMA

PÜSI KRÜPTO EESOTSAS

Toimetatud iganädalaselt
Toimetatud iganädalaselt

Olge krüptos sammu võrra ees meie iganädalase uudiskirjaga, mis toob teieni kõige olulisemad teadmised.

news icon

Iganädalane krüptouudised, koostatud teie jaoks

insights icon

Tegutsema kutsuvad teadmised ja harivad näpunäited

products icon

Toodete uuendused, mis toetavad majanduslikku vabadust

Registreeru

Ei rämpsposti. Võimalus igal ajal loobuda.

Alusta turvalist investeerimist Bitcoin.com Walletiga.Alusta turvalist investeerimist Bitcoin.com Walletiga.Alusta turvalist investeerimist Bitcoin.com Walletiga.

Alusta turvalist investeerimist Bitcoin.com Walletiga.

Üle rahakoti on seni loodud

Kõik, mida vajate, et osta, müüa, kaubelda ja investeerida oma Bitcoini ja krüptovaluutasse turvaliselt.

App StoreGoogle PlayQR Code
Download App